My friend was an AMC/Jeep salesman in Connecticut back in the 70s/80s, and he said snow plows were an amazing sales tool. You tell a young guy that if he spends a couple hundred bucks extra on a plow, his Jeep CJ will pay for itself. Sealed the deal in a lot of cases.
